ResumoWe investigate single top production in the presence of anomalous Wtb couplings. We explicitly show that, if these couplings arise from gauge invariant effective operators, the only relevant couplings for single top production and decay are the usual γμ and σμνqν terms, where q is the W boson momentum. This happens even in the single top production processes where the Wtb interaction involves off-shell top and/or bottom quarks. With this parameterisation for the Wtb vertex, we obtain expressions for the dependence on anomalous couplings of the single top cross sections, for (i) the t-channel process, performing a matching between tj and tb¯j production, where j is a light jet; (ii) s-channel tb¯ production; (iii) associated tW− production, including the correction from tW−b¯. We use these expressions to estimate, with a fast detector simulation, the simultaneous limits which the measurement of single top cross sections at LHC will set on Vtb and possible anomalous couplings. Finally, a combination with top decay asymmetries and angular distributions is performed, showing how the limits can be improved when the latter are included in a global fit to Wtb couplings.
